INTERVIEW: NICOLAS KENT and GILLIAN SLOVO

The artistic director of the Tricycle Theatre and writer talk to Dominic Cavendish about The Riots, an attempt to create a rapid-reaction verbatim drama in response to the riots that swept across England in August 2011.

We’re not saying the people burnt out of their houses aren’t as much a victim as someone who feels the need to riot because they’ve had – or they think they’ve had – a deprived upbringing or been unfairly discriminated against. We try to give everyone a voice.
